Job description

The Associate Merchant is responsible for assisting the Sr Buyer or Merch Manager in all aspects of the department business in order to drive results that meet or exceed the planned financial objectives season to season and helps support administrative needs for the department. Will Assume full responsibility for a classification or classifications as assigned by the Sr. Buyer or Merch manager, while also supporting the dept. This position will help manage assortment buys, product pricing, creating, and maintaining meeting notes, maintaining vendor relationships, and help create Inspo Boards for upcoming season trends.

 

Essential Functions:

 

  • Drives sales and margin through product development, vendor communications and executing all business strategies
  • Manages and updates Monthly Merchandise Incoming Styles Documentation
  • Create and manage Vendor Master Document for subset of vendors to allow visibility for all confirmed and unconfirmed orders
  • Creates Monthly Assortment Doc
  • Attend and participate in daily buying meetings with all vendors. Helps document selection of new product, negotiate costing, set retails, place orders in a timely fashion, and effectively follow up on all production approvals
  • Partners with Marketing and Merchandise Manager on Marketing Emails ideas, Daily Takeovers, Edits, and Capsule Collections as needed
  • Creates, enters + Maintains buying meeting notes
  • Review weekly selling to make suggestions and Identify gaps in future assortments, assess opportunities in the assortment, cancel on order at risk and manage RTV’s as needed
  • Manages vendor relationships including meeting scheduling, weekly selling reports, ad hoc communication, and other vendor recaps as needed
  • Proficiency in Purchase Order upload and Maintenance to support Merchandise Coordinator during peak periods
  • Attends and contributes to gathering data for quarterly hindsight meeting to discuss the buying needs + trends for the upcoming seasons
  • Helps compiles Inspo/Trends decks for upcoming seasons based off direction from leadership
  • Have expert knowledge of the VICI customer and competitor activities. Identify key trends in the marketplace and translate those trends to the VICI customer
  • Attend Weekly Fittings by Vendor
